Wall Street could boost BTC bounty

Francis Pouliot, CEO at http://BullBitcoin.com, questioned whether spending from a specific Bitcoin address would require breaking bitcoin cryptography.

He suggested that if this is the case, Wall Street players should consider funding it with 1000 BTC or a similar amount, given that a current bounty of 0.27 BTC is not seen as substantial.

Pouliot has previously drawn attention to Bitcoin’s high standards and privacy issues compared to other crypto platforms. In a separate post, he noted that Costa Rica already accepts Bitcoin, highlighting the country’s openness to cryptocurrency transactions. His recent comments add to his ongoing engagement with Bitcoin-related topics.
